Super Mario Odyssey is going to be a masterpiece. All indications are that it will end up being an even better game than The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ild, which was already one of the greatest games ever made when it launched earlier this year.

And now, we have started to see the first indication that the game will end up living up to the gargantuan expectations that surround it. Super Mario Odyssey has received its very first review ever – from EDGE – and it has gotten a rare 10/10 from them. This makes it the 20th game ever to receive this top honor, the fourth game this generation, and the second game this year (after Breath of the Wild).

It remains to be seen whether or not the game ends up receiving this kind of reception from other outlets (including from us at GamingBolt)- however, assuming it does, it may end up with aggregate scores similar to Breath of the Wild, which, with a Metascore of 97, is the highest rated game of the last 9 years, and one of the highest rated games of all time.

Super Mario Odyssey launches on October 27 exclusively for the Nintendo Switch.
